Cover letters are recommended, and often required, for job applications. If you want to stand out from other candidates, it is important that you write a unique cover letter for each position to which you apply. Cover letters should clarify and expand upon your most relevant skills and competencies. In addition, a cover letter should showcase your written communication skills.
